Other neighborhoods around Arndell Park
Parramatta
Major CBD and suburb, Parramatta boasts lush Parramatta Park, bustling Westfield shopping center, and diverse dining options on Church Street. Easily accessible via trains, buses, and ferries.
Liverpool
Travelers enjoy Liverpool for its shopping and sporting events. Consider checking out Westfield Liverpool while you're in the area.
Penrith
Unique features of Penrith include the shopping and restaurants. Make a stop by Westfield Penrith Shopping Centre or BlueBet Stadium while you're exploring the area.
Sydney Olympic Park
Featuring a large sports and entertainment area, commercial developments, and extensive parklands, this Greater Western Sydney suburb offers attractions like Bicentennial Park and Newington Armory. Easily accessible via Olympic Park railway line and ferry services.
Chatswood
Chatswood is known for its abundant dining options, and you can plan a trip to Chatswood Interchange and Lane Cove National Park while you're in town.
Darling Harbour
Adjacent to Sydney's city centre, Darling Harbour boasts a pedestrian precinct with attractions like the Australian National Maritime Museum and Chinese Garden of Friendship. Enjoy dining at Cockle Bay Wharf, explore Tumbalong Park, and access various transport options, including the Inner West Light Rail and ferry services.
